What’s included

  • Meals
    Continental Breakfast (B), Lunch (L) and Dinner (D) as follows: Day 1: (D). Day 2: (B, L, D). Day 3: (B, L, D). Day 4: (B, L, D). Day 5: (B). Snacks and beverages also supplied at workshop.
  • Lodging (4 nights)
    Lodging for four nights is included. Participants will share a beautiful rental home with fellow attendees, each enjoying a private bedroom and bathroom.
  • Instruction
    We provide multiple instructors to ensure you have abundant help with questions and more.
  • Ground Transportation
    Your registration price includes ground transportation and transfers to/from the Billings, MT Logan Airport to Red Lodge, MT, to your lodging, and daily trips to the workshop location.
  • Lighting
    Anytime additional lighting (i.e., reflectors, flash, constant lights, etc.) are needed, the gear is provided to you to use during the workshop. (Instruction provided.)
  • Pre-workshop webinar
    A group webinar on Monday, July 28, 2025 at 7pm EDT / 6pm CDT / 5pm MDT / 4pm PDT will be held. (Recording available.)
  • Pre-workshop tutorial
    An on-demand course on using Manual Exposure settings is provided. and may be accessed at your leisure.
  • Post-workshop webinar
    A follow-up webinar on Tues., Oct 28, 2025 at 7pm EDT / 6pm CDT / 5pm MDT / 4pm PDT to share images, receive post-processing tips from Lisa Langell, and more.

What’s not included

  • Highly specialized diet
    We can accommodate most common allergies and dietary needs. For specialized or extensive requirements, you may need to supplement your meals. A grocery store is nearby. We're happy to take you there.
  • Gratuities
    Gratuities (tips) for the ranch staff and your workshop team are not included.
  • Photo Gear & Accessories
    Please bring camera bod(ies), tripod, remote trigger, a wide, mid-range, and long-range zoom lens, batteries, memory cards, and related gear for backing up images. Details provided after registration

A nature photographer and birder from the age of eight, Lisa is the founder of Langell Photography, LLC. She began her own business in 2010 after long vibrant careers as a floral designer, educational psychologist, consultant and in helping launch and manage two startups that grew into leading companies in the Ed-Tech space. Since then, she has earned numerous awards, is an Image Master for Tamron Americas and has been published in Outdoor Photographer, Arizona Highways, Ranger Rick and more.
